Living in the shadow of a generational talent must be tough, but Ace Flagg is making a name for himself in his own right.

The twin brother of Cooper Flagg - the highly touted prospect projected to go No. 1 overall to the Dallas Mavericks at the upcoming Draft - Ace currently stars at Greensboro Day School in North Carolina.

Looming at 6‑8 and listed at roughly 180–210 lbs, Ace plays primarily at forward.

As for his career path so far, he spent his sophomore and junior years at Montverde Academy in Florida in a program packed to the brim with elite talent, featuring from the bench as they captured the championship.

The three-star prospect in the 2025 recruiting class was actually part of the same class as his brother until Cooper decided to reclassify into the in order to be able to feature for the Blue Devils.

In late 2024, Ace committed to play for Maine Black Bears, a decision that reflected his strong connection to Maine: his mother played there, his grandparents live nearby, and Ace himself helped host a basketball camp in Orono.

The 18-year-old ranks 272nd nationally in 2025 according to data from 247Sports By those same metrics, and he ranks 55th among all power forwards and 20th among prospects in North Carolina.
